Ensuring a radiant skin appearance requires more than just good genes—it necessitates a committed skin maintenance routine. As the most exposed organ, it encounters various external aggressors, sun exposure, and other influences that impact its condition. A structured regimen that includes washing, moisturizing, face masks, concentrated treatments, and pure oils is essential to keeping skin that remains youthful and resilient.
Washing the face every day forms the foundation of maintaining clear skin. Throughout the day, the surface gathers dirt, oil, and pollutants, that, when ignored, often result in clogged pores, lack of radiance, and other concerns. A good face wash removes these deposits, ensuring a clean skin surface. Yet, one must to use a mild face wash appropriate for one’s skin type to avoid irritation. Using harsh cleansers may strip essential moisture, causing inflammation. Sensitive skin types must choose hypoallergenic products. People prone to shine may prefer foaming cleansers that regulate oil while maintaining hydration. Nourishing products suit dehydrated skin, ensuring hydration while cleansing.
After washing, hydration becomes essential for protecting the skin. Hydrating lotions help to restore moisture, stopping flakiness or redness. Regardless of skin condition, keeping moisture intact is key. People dealing with acne can opt for gel-based hydrators that nourish without greasiness. Parched complexions, a richer formula helps sustain comfort. People with fluctuating skin needs benefits from tailored formulations to maintain equilibrium. With consistent use, properly chosen products ensures skin elasticity.
Facial oils are highly recommended because they provide deep hydration. Unlike here conventional moisturizers, natural oils sink in quickly to provide skin barrier support. Oils like squalane oil, which contain vitamins, aid in healing. For individuals with excessive sebum, non-comedogenic options such as squalane regulate oil production. Dry or mature skin types see the most results with nutrient-dense oils like moringa, to combat fine lines. Adding a beauty oil into your skincare practice supports a plump complexion, leading to a luminous appearance.
